Technical Environment

Operate within a sophisticated agentic AI landscape, utilizing Python 3.* with specialized agent frameworks including LangChain, LlamaIndex, AutoGen, and custom agent orchestration systems. Leverage core ML fr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ch alongside LLM APIs, vector databases, and agent-specific tools. Work with BigQuery, Apache Beam, Apache Spark, Kubeflow, Dataflow, Kubernetes, Kafka, Pub/Sub, and Flask in building scalable agent infrastructure. Our agentic architecture follows event-driven, autonomous, and self-monitoring principles within a secure multi-tenant Microservices design, hosted on Azure Cloud with specialized agent runtime environments.
